Stash Blend Plant Additive: Biology, Nutrition, and Silicon in One Formula
Stash Blend runs a 2-1-5 NPK built from corn steep liquor, seaweed extract (Ascophyllum nodosum), and potassium hydroxide — a potassium-forward base that pairs cleanly with the nitrogen-heavy stages of Stash Base and the PK push of Stash Bloom. All nitrogen is water-soluble, so uptake starts at application with no waiting on mineralization. Beyond the NPK, 3.0% humic acid improves cation exchange and nutrient retention in the root zone, and 0.5% soluble silicon reinforces cell wall structure throughout.
Bacillus Species Counts, Mycorrhizal Strains, and Dosing Across the Stash Program
Four Bacillus species anchor the microbial side: Bacillus licheniformis at 1×10⁸ CFU/g leads the pack for nutrient cycling and pathogen suppression, followed by Bacillus pasteurii at 1×10⁷ CFU/g, Bacillus subtilis at 7×10⁶ CFU/g, and Paenibacillus azotofixans at 5.5×10⁶ CFU/g — the latter fixing atmospheric nitrogen directly in the root zone. Four endo mycorrhizal strains (Glomus intraradices, mosseae, aggregatum, and etunicatum at 7 prop/g each) extend effective root surface area and pull in water and nutrients beyond what roots reach on their own. Mix at ½–1 tsp per gallon of water, added last when building your nutrient solution.

Guaranteed Analysis (2-1-5)
| Ingredient / Organism | Amount / Count |
|---|---|
| Plant Food Nutrients | |
| Total Nitrogen (N) — Water Soluble | 2.0% |
| Available Phosphate (P₂O₅) | 1.0% |
| Soluble Potash (K₂O) | 5.0% |
| Non-Plant Food Ingredients | |
| Humic Acid | 3.0% |
| Soluble Silicon (Si) | 0.5% |
| Beneficial Bacteria | |
| Bacillus licheniformis | 1×10⁸ CFU/g |
| Bacillus pasteurii | 1×10⁷ CFU/g |
| Bacillus subtilis | 7×10⁶ CFU/g |
| Paenibacillus azotofixans | 5.5×10⁶ CFU/g |
| Endo Mycorrhizae | |
| Glomus intraradices | 7 prop/g |
| Glomus mosseae | 7 prop/g |
| Glomus aggregatum | 7 prop/g |
| Glomus etunicatum | 7 prop/g |
Derived from: Corn Steep Liquor, Seaweed Extract (Ascophyllum nodosum), Potassium Hydroxide.

Directions and Storage
| Topic | Details |
|---|---|
| Dose Rate | ½ to 1 tsp per gallon of water. Add last when mixing with a nutrient solution. |
| Shelf Life | 2 years when stored in a cool, dry place away from direct sunlight. |
| Clumping | Normal. Simply break up the powder before measuring — it remains fully effective. |
